Search Results for 120

Vault 120

Vault 120

Wiki Page

Vault 120 is a cut Vault-Tec Vault located off the Atlantic coast of Massachusetts, underwater in the Commonwealth. It would have been involved in the cut quest 20 Leagues Under the Sea. The adventure in Fallout Wiki

View More Wiki Articles